Transaction 146342687bf59f0abadad809f493b49eb378382e73d05bc65e12eebaaabb4c95

1 Input
2 Outputs
  • 146342687bf59f0abadad809f493b49eb378382e73d05bc65e12eebaaabb4c95:0
  • value  620200
    address  1DFHggqhZ8svMyPu8gA4HEXqKdi9ud5Gnb
  • 146342687bf59f0abadad809f493b49eb378382e73d05bc65e12eebaaabb4c95:1
  • value  1689367
    address  13eQGLaTCrinpReNeABDzxhTwGijuQ2dxf